MEMO TO THE BOARD

Re: Proposed sale of the Quillbrook Analytics unit

Management has concluded initial diligence with the prospective buyer, Ashentor Holdings. The unit's carve-out costs are within the range previously presented, and employee transfer terms are broadly agreed. A term sheet is expected within three weeks. The board should note the strategic rationale summarised in the confidential annex below.

management briefing: Project Ulavan slips by two quarters because of the staffing delay.

### Handover Note — Loyalty Points Ledger (Brindlehop)

Welcome aboard. The Brindlehop points ledger reconciles nightly; if the reconciliation job stalls, check the outbox table for stuck entries before anything else. Never edit balances directly — use the adjustment tool, which writes compensating entries. The adjustment tool's admin mode is sealed, and it will prompt you once for the recovery passphrase given below.

vault phrase of tajef-tafog = istox-sorax-zorox-casok-holox-kelix-weneth-drueth-casion

**Mgmt Meeting Minutes — Retiring the Brightline Range**

Quick recap for sales leads at Fenholt Supplies: we agreed to retire the Brightline fixture range by year-end. Remaining stock moves to clearance pricing next month, and accounts on standing orders get migrated to the Lumetta range. Trade-in incentives were approved in principle. The confidential note on next steps sits just below.

board note of bajof-bajeg: The pricing group signed off on a budget of $13.4 million for Project Sildor. The renewal with Lamixek Holdings closes at $48.9 million a year, 49 percent above the last contract.

Alert: PortionWise scaling errors exceed 2% over 10 minutes. The recipe-scaling calculator is returning wrong quantities or 500s. Usual causes: unit-conversion table failed to load, or upstream ingredient service timeout. Check the converter health dashboard first, then worker logs. Restarting the conversion cache pod resolves most cases. If errors persist past 20 minutes, page the on-call and file an incident. Questions go to the service owner.

alerts address for kajog-tadup: druox@plorvanet.internal